This is the powerhouse of the bunch with a massive 500W total output. I was able to charge my MacBook Pro 16″ from 0% to 40% in about 30 minutes using the dual 100W PD ports, and still had six other ports free for my phone, tablet, and gaming controller. The 5ft detachable power cord gives you flexibility on your desk setup, and the compact size saves about 50% space compared to bulky chargers I’ve used before. The only downside is it doesn’t include any charging cables, so you’ll need to supply your own.

Right out of the box, I appreciated that Multixel includes two 100W USB-C to USB-C cables and one 30W USB-C to Lightning cable — that’s a solid value add. The 240W GaN3 technology keeps things cool, and I noticed the charger stayed at a low temperature even when I had it running at full capacity. With 7 USB-C ports and 1 USB-A port, it covers all my devices, and the 100W PD on port C1 charged my laptop quickly. My only real complaint is that the 240W total power might feel limited if you’re trying to charge two high-powered laptops simultaneously.

This is the most affordable option, and it works well for what it is — a dedicated phone and tablet charger. Each of the 4 USB-C ports delivers a steady 20W, and I loved the no-buzz design that keeps things quiet on my desk. The compact size at only 3.8 x 3 x 1.3 inches and lightweight 256g build makes it super portable for travel. But here’s the catch: DMBKYLM explicitly states it’s not for laptops, so if you’re a gamer needing to charge a gaming laptop, this won’t cut it. It’s perfect for a secondary charging hub on a nightstand or for charging phones, earbuds, and smartwatches.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is better for a gaming laptop — the FOLIZGE 500W or the Multixel 240W?

The FOLIZGE 500W is the clear winner for gaming laptops. It has two 100W PD ports that can charge a powerful gaming laptop at full speed, while the Multixel only has one 100W port and the rest are 30W or 45W. If you’re trying to charge a high-end gaming laptop like an ASUS ROG or MSI Stealth, the FOLIZGE’s 500W total output gives you the headroom you need without worrying about power limits.

Can the DMBKYLM charge a laptop?

No, and I want to be clear about this — the DMBKYLM is explicitly not for laptops. Each of its 4 USB-C ports only delivers 20W, which is fine for phones and tablets but nowhere near enough for a laptop. If you need to charge a laptop, go with the FOLIZGE or the Multixel instead.

Is the FOLIZGE worth the extra money over the Multixel?

It depends on what you’re charging. If you only have one laptop and a few phones or accessories, the Multixel’s 240W with included cables and lifetime warranty is a fantastic deal. But if you need to charge two laptops simultaneously or want the highest power ceiling possible, the FOLIZGE’s 500W and dual 100W PD ports are absolutely worth the upgrade.

Which charging station comes with cables included?

Only the Multixel 240W includes cables right in the box — you get two 100W USB-C to USB-C nylon cables and one 30W USB-C to Lightning cable. The FOLIZGE and the DMBKYLM do not include any charging cables, so you’ll need to buy or reuse your own for those.

Which one is best for travel?

The DMBKYLM is the most travel-friendly at only 3.8 x 3 x 1.3 inches and 256g, but it can’t charge laptops. If you need laptop charging on the go, the Multixel 240W is the better travel pick because it’s 35% smaller than traditional chargers thanks to GaN3 technology and includes cables so you pack less. The FOLIZGE is bulkier at 4.33 x 2.95 x 4.33 inches and better suited for a permanent desk setup.
